HVAC stands for Heating, Ventilation, and Air Conditioning. This system works to regulate your indoor climate by controlling temperature and air quality. A well-functioning HVAC system not only enhances comfort but also ensures energy efficiency.
Types of HVAC Systems Available Central Air Conditioning Ductless Mini-Split Systems Heat Pumps Furnaces BoilersUnderstanding these options helps you choose the best system tailored to your needs.

Regular Maintenance: The Key to Longevity Importance of Routine InspectionsJust like getting regular check-ups at the doctor’s office, your HVAC system needs routine inspections to function effectively. Regular maintenance can prevent costly repairs down the line.
What Does Routine Maintenance Include? Checking thermostat settings Cleaning or replacing filters Inspecting ductwork Checking refrigerant levelsBy scheduling maintenance twice a year—once before winter and once before summer—you can extend the life of your system.
Energy-Efficient Heating Options for Your Home Benefits of Heat Pumps in SpringfieldHeat pumps are an excellent alternative to traditional heating methods. They are highly efficient as they transfer heat rather than generating it directly.
Advantages of Heat Pumps:
Lower operating costs Environmentally friendly Versatility (heating & cooling)If you're considering a new installation or replacement, think about opting for a heat pump!

Duct Cleaning: Why It’s Essential? The Benefits of Clean DuctsOver time, dust, allergens, and debris accumulate in your ducts, which can significantly impact indoor air quality and hinder heating/cooling efficiency.
Key Advantages of Duct Cleaning:
Improved airflow Enhanced air quality Increased energy efficiencyScheduling duct cleaning services regularly will ensure optimal performance from your HVAC system.
Enhancing Efficiency with Smart Thermostats What Are Smart Thermostats?Smart thermostats allow homeowners to control their home temperature remotely via smartphone apps or voice commands—making it easy to manage indoor climates effectively.
How Do They Save Energy?
Learning your schedule Adjusting temperatures automatically Providing usage reportsSwitching to a smart thermostat could be one of the best investments you make!

FAQs About Efficient Heating and Cooling How often should I schedule HVAC maintenance? Ideally twice a year—before summer and winter seasons. What signs indicate my furnace needs repair? Look out for strange noises or uneven heating patterns. Can I clean my ducts myself? While some DIY cleaning methods exist, professional cleaning is recommended for comprehensive results. What is the average lifespan of an HVAC system? Most systems last between 15-20 years with proper maintenance. Are smart thermostats worth it? Yes! They optimize energy usage based on habits.6 . What's the difference between tankless water heaters versus traditional ones?
Tankless units heat water on demand; thus they’re more energy-efficient over time compared to conventional tanks that continuously store hot water.
